OMG - I got out of the water yesterday - sat the board in the sun for a little while chatting on the beach, and then as I was loading it in the van, I noticed some water bubbling out of some tiny little pin holes near the tail !!!

Looks like she has sucked up some water, what do i do ??

Hi Sunny sup ,

What type of board is it?

For now stand the board up vertical and put a towel under the tail.

you must get all the water out before you get it repaired.
